Try something like this: field = form.fields['property'] data = form.cleaned_data['property'] if isinstance(data, (list, tuple)): # for multi-selects friendly_name = [x[1] for x in field.field.choices if x[0] in data] else: # for single selects friendly_name = [x[1] for x in field.field.choices if x[0] == data]
